Hintergrund
- FANCF belongs to a multi subunit complex composed of FANCA, FANCC, FANCF and FANCG proteins. It is a DNA repair protein that may operate in postreplication repair or a cell cycle checkpoint function. It may be implicated in interstrand DNA cross-link repair and in the maintenance of normal chromosome stability.Synonyms: FACF, Fanconi anemia group F protein
